Handover: Tomas → Priya, re: Ledgerline billing worker. Blue-green deploys are live as of this sprint. Green pool drains invoice jobs before cutover; verify the drain counter hits zero before flipping traffic, or duplicate charges are possible. Rollback is one toggle, but wait two full billing cycles first. Full runbook with cutover checklist is here:

operations page: https://jira.qorvelsys.internal/browse/pages/browse/pages

## v4.2.1 — Key Rotation

As part of the Lanternfold schema migration work, we rotated the deploy credentials used by the zero-downtime migration runner. Migrations now apply in two phases (expand, then contract) so the Quillbase cluster never blocks reads. If you're new: the runner picks up its key from the vault at boot, so no manual steps are needed after rotation. For local verification against staging, use the new deploy key below.

signing key of bagap-yawep = bky13_TbfT6ZMUoGJo2

Action item from the Brindlewharf pick-list incident: the optimizer's route batching grew unbounded under peak load, delaying pickers by up to eleven minutes. Support should verify the new caps are applied on every site controller and escalate any override requests. For reference during triage, the agreed tuning constants are reproduced below.

limits module of fajog-tawig:
RATE_LIMITS = {
    "druwyn": 2,
    "quenael": 10,
    "wenix": 2,
    "druael": 2,
}